4 Corners Location

The 4 Corners area is usually a quadripoint region in The us exactly where the boundaries are formed with the four states on the country. These 4 states, Utah, Colorado, New Mexico and Arizona, all meet in a single one geographic location called 4 Corners Monument the place They're bounded by two straight traces that kind a cross and four suitable angles. It is the sole U.S. location where by 4 on the country’s states satisfy.

History

The Tale powering the establishment on the Four Corners location is often traced back to that time in the event the U.S. Military defeated and invaded Mexico from the 1846 Mexican-American War. Adhering to the ratification of your Guadalupe y Hidalgo treaty, the U.S. obtained control of several states such as Utah, Nevada, California, which include portions of Colorado, New Mexico, Arizona and Wyoming.

In 1868, the U.S. Authorities Surveyors and Astronomers experienced surveyed the 4 Corners prior to Colorado’s preparing for statehood and its admission into the Union. The move demarcated the southern boundary line of Colorado. Ten yrs later on, the west boundary of New Mexico and japanese boundary of Utah were surveyed and extra. Once the boundary of the Arizona territory was extra while in the demarcation, the 4 Corners location became officially founded.

4 Corners Monument

The 1st study monument was a sandstone marker which was erected in 1899. Later, it was replaced that has a cement and tiny steel marker in 1912. In 1922, the monument further evolved into a copper disc uncovered inside a surface crafted from granite material. New enhancements ended up obtained in 2010 when two intersecting strains ended up established which went through the disc Centre to mark the boundaries. Indigenous American Tribes

Besides environment the boundaries of 4 U.S. states, the 4 Corners also designed the distinct boundaries between two Indigenous American tribes which include the Ute Mountain Ute along with the Navajo Country. The latter preserves the monument as a crucial vacationer attraction.
